Mobbish
adj
adj ·Rare ·Advanced level
Definitions
Adjective
- 1 like a mob, characteristic of a mob
"Mobbish feeling always inclines to violence."
Adjective
- 1 characteristic of a mob; disorderly or lawless wordnet
